Double Turn changes
Quick update here! I've released a new patch that includes some minor AI improvements and updates to Solo modes. Additionally, I've added some new guides and a new Bug & Support forum I'd like to highlight.
v0.19.1 Patch Notes
Decrease AI difficulty
Add more variety in AI actions and strategy
Add random palette swaps to AI characters
Double time between wrestler spawns in Battle Royal solo mode
Show controls before every Solo match
Hopefully the AI is a little easier to fight, less aggressive and the response times aren't inhumanly fast. Like mentioned in the last update, this won't be the final AI, just some small tweaks to make the AI less difficult but also less repetitive. Battle Royal is still pretty difficult to survive all 20 opponents (it's a marathon of a challenge mode), but it should be much more doable to get further into the fight and even beat. I made no changes to Gauntlet structure since it's regular matches just back-to-back, the AI behavior changes alone should be enough!
Bug & Support forum
I've added a separate discussion board in the Steam forums dedicated to bug reporting and support. Please post there if you have any issues! I've also added a pinned post for controller support where I've linked to a testing tool that will help track down device compatibility issues.
Official Guides
I also added some guides to the community hub as well. Hopefully that'll help get people started with the basics and setup until a proper training or tutorial mode is ready!
Future updates
Hopefully this patch as well as the guides help getting started!
For this next update I will be doing a lot of combat balancing on various different aspects of the game. I feel like it makes sense to put it out in drips as I rebalance each area, but since I may experiment and rollback changes I don't want to do that all on the main store version. If you'd like to keep up-to-date with all those changes you can subscribe to the public "next" beta branch (you can find a guide for that in the community hub)! I'll make small patch notes as I go but fair warning these will be rougher updates and probably not heavily bug tested.
A final note: Outside of bug fixes, the next update will be the last one for Early Access, as I will focus the rest of my development efforts on prepping the game for launch and will be introducing all those launch features with a big 1.0 update.
